1. Basics of T-Shirt Sketching: Tools and Techniques
First things first, you don’t need a studio full of expensive equipment to get started. All you really need is a pencil, some paper, and an eraser. For beginners, a simple HB pencil works wonders. Start by lightly sketching the outline of your t-shirt. Think of it as drawing a rectangle with rounded corners – pretty straightforward, right? Once you’ve got the basic shape down, you can start adding details like the neckline, sleeves, and any graphics or text you want to include. Remember, practice makes perfect, so don’t worry if your first few attempts look a bit wonky. Keep going, and you’ll see improvement in no time! 📐✏️

3. Tips for Perfecting Your Sketches: From Novice to Pro
So, you’ve got the hang of sketching t-shirts and adding your unique touch. But how do you take your skills to the next level? Here are a few tips to help you refine your technique:
- Practice shading: Add depth and dimension to your sketches by playing with light and shadow. This can make your t-shirt designs look more realistic and visually appealing.
- Experiment with different mediums: While pencils are great for beginners, don’t hesitate to try out other materials like markers, colored pencils, or even digital drawing tools. Each medium offers its own set of challenges and opportunities.
- Study professional designs: Take inspiration from existing t-shirt designs. Look at how professionals use lines, colors, and textures to create engaging visuals. This can give you ideas and techniques to incorporate into your own work.
